Additionally, if you do not want to use the 
annual ambient temperature as your boundary wall 
temperature, you can use the temperature of 
undisturbed ground as calculated by the Kasuda 
correlation from Type77. This makes the ground 
temperature a function of depth and time of year. 
Like with Arie's response, it assumes that the 
ground is an infinite source / sink and that 
energy transferred from the building through the 
wall to the ground does not affect the ground 
temperature in the long term. We have written a 
few basement models recently that do account for 
the change in the ground temperature due to 
energy transfer through the wall but they assume 
four basement walls and a floor. If you only have 
one wall below grade then you might be best off 
using Arie's method either with the annual 
average ground temperature or with Type77.
